212kg tuna sold for $271,000 at Japan’s auction
A bluefin tuna weighing 212kg was sold for $271,000 at Tokyo’s first auction in 2023, though not setting a record, TASS reports
It turned out that, this year, the price for the lot sold – a tuna brought from the port of Oma in northern Aomori Prefecture – was too low. The absolute record was set in 2019: a tuna weighing 278kg was then sold for more than $3m.
Actually, representatives of the restaurant industry believe the first auctions at the beginning of a year are very important, since their bargains will contribute to business success, also assisting in attraction of customers who are lining up to treat themselves with the most expensive fish.
